Has anyone put one of these on a .375 yet? Seems like great option especially if using light long range bullets.
sightron2-10x32.jpg

32mm obj, 30mm tube, 3.6-4.2in eye relief
 
the varying eye relief is a worry.
3.6" can bite you on a 375.
not that many more expensive scopes are any better in this regard.
bruce.
 
Won't you have varying relief with any variable
power scope though? I had the first version of this with a standard reticle and it didn't seem to be an issue on a .375H&H
This one seems to have some better features
 
albert,
eye relief does not have to vary much in variables.
some have more of this than others.
the same issue appears in scopes used by f class shooters to a greater or lesser degree.
manufacturers just need to put a higher priority on design.
on lower powers there is more latitude in useable eye relief, and as powers increase the band gets narrower., as well as closer.
mostly you won't get hit in the head, but sometimes you have to shoot uphill from a less than optimum hold and then ouch.
there are scopes with longer eye relief, like 4", on max and min power, but you have to look for them.
a good scope cut makes you bleed like a stuck pig, and is a good step forward towards a flinch.
